## Ticket: Config drift in Ferngate shipping-fee rules engine

The production rules engine has drifted from the repository-managed baseline: two fee brackets were edited directly in the admin console, bypassing review. This means deploys from main would silently revert live pricing. Proposed fix is to re-sync the repo to match production intent, then lock console edits. For review, the values currently live in production are reproduced below.

service settings:
PRAIX_LOG_LEVEL=error
PRAIX_METRICS_HOST=metrics.praix.qorvelcorp.corp
PRAIX_POOL_SIZE=16

Management Meeting Minutes — Support Outsourcing

Present: Dario Fenwright, Lena Cossu, Arvid Malloran. Reviewed proposal to outsource tier-1 customer support for the Pellorin product line to Havensea Services. Projected saving: 18% annually. Risks noted: handover quality, contract exit terms. Action: Lena to finalise cost model by Friday; Arvid to draft SLA requirements. Decision deferred to next session pending finance sign-off. Rationale and timing considerations appear in the confidential note below.

confidential, fahip-bagep: The southern region missed its Holwyn quota by 21.5 percent last quarter. Sorvanek Foods plans to raise the Jorir list price by 23.9 percent in December. The pricing group signed off on a budget of $411.6 million for Project Eliion. The renewal with Juldorix Works closes at $87.9 million a year, 16.8 percent below the last contract.

Handover note — Crumbwheel order cutoffs.

Welcome aboard. The bakery cutoff rule in Crumbwheel closes same-day orders at 14:00 local to each storefront, not UTC — this has bitten us twice. Holiday overrides live in the calendar service and take precedence silently, so always check there first when a cutoff looks wrong. To unlock the calendar service's admin console after a restart, enter the recovery passphrase below.

vault phrase of bagap-bahaf = silion-pelox-sorox-casdor-quenwyn-fraax-eliox-praael-kelion-quenvan-kasox-rusael-norius-belvan